The HDV-like ribozyme found in an intron of the cytoplasmic poly-adenylation element binding protein 3 (CPEB3) gene is highly conserved in mammals [4], and humans homozygous for a single nucleotide polymorphism (SNP) known to affect CPEB3 ribozyme activity show differences in episodic memory [11]. Ribozymes (ribonucleic acid enzymes) are RNA molecules that have the ability to catalyze specific biochemical reactions, including RNA splicing in gene expression, similar to the action of protein enzymes. Webb19 mars 2024 · We engineered and selected a holopolymerase ribozyme that uses a sigma factor–like specificity primer to first recognize an RNA promoter sequence and then, in a second step, rearrange to a processive elongation form.
